Great Printer...When it doesn't Jam! October 19, 2008 I purchased this printer about a month ago through an Amazon reseller and it took about five days to arrive. The packaging is really good and it's relatively easy to unbox. The installation instructions are the best I've ever seen with a printer (the click-through videos show you exactly what you need to do to get it ready to print). Installing the drivers and adding the printer is a snap once it's connected to your network. It took less than an hour from the time it arrived to the time I printed my first page.
Unfortunately, it took less than a day for my first paper jam to occur. It has jammed frequently and it seems to be completely random when it jams. Sometimes I've printed 50 page documents without a hiccup and other times I just try to print a 5 page document which ends up taking 15 minutes to clear the rollers, try again, clear the rollers, and try again. I've probably had to throw away a couple dozen sheets of crinkled up paper this past month from all the paper jams. I've tried opening it up and reseating the imager and the toner cartridges; all fruitless attempts at preventing future jams.
Also, this printer is pretty loud. If you are used to a nearly silent ink jet, you'll be surprised at how much noise this thing creates when it's cranking out 50 page reports.
One other note, this printer is rather large for a desk. If you don't have a considerable amount of desk space or a table to place it on, you might want to measure before buying one.
Overall, the Xerox Phaser 6130 gets 3 out of 5 stars. When this printer actually prints and doesn't jam, the quality is pretty good. It is easy to unbox and setup; the price is pretty competitive too. However all the jams and the loud printing takes down what could have been a great score.

Xerox Phaser 6130 - Great Quality and Convenience October 16, 2008
The Xerox Phaser 6130/N Color Laser Printer is a very nice color laser printer with a sleek durable body and a cool functional design. The performance is very good and the quality of print-outs is also good for most general color printing needs. Those with more specific specialized needs, such as high volume or large format photo quality printing, will probably want to look at some alternatives. Still, among general use color laser printers the 6130 is a very attractive option.
Features, Upgrades, Service
In terms of speeds this unit is very fast compared to inkjets and color laser printers, but many black and white laser printers are faster. So if your primary needs are black and white printing and speed, you may want to consider a B&W laser printer. If you will be printing more than occasionally in color, the speed benefits of color printing far outweigh the few extra seconds of wait time on black and white print-outs.
The internal memory is certainly enough for general printing needs. However, 128 MB will not be adequate for those printing large color presentations. Power users will want to upgrade immediately. If you purchase your own compatible memory you will save some money versus purchasing through Xerox.
The toner cartridges are somewhat expensive, but not more so than most laser printer cartridges. The high cost is mostly off-set by the longer useful life. Unlike your inkjet printer, you should be able to go a while before having to change toner. The fact that the cartridges are pre-loaded is great, and the placement of the access door on the side is a GREAT design feature that makes accessing and changing toner much easier than printers from competing brands.
Installation
The included instructions guide novices in setting up your printer, changing the toner cartridges and other basics. I think the instructions are adequate is somewhat minimalist. You have to look at the steps carefully. Setting up your network connection could have included more information, but most users will only need the default setup. While there is a USB connection option as well, it seems like kind of a shame to not get the benefits of the network setup. Hooking this printer up to your wireless router is quite easy.
The driver setup program needs the printer to be online in order to be completed. You have to complete the printer setup beforehand to ensure that it has an IP and is accessible over the network. After installation, you can register your printer online for warrantee and support needs.
The Competition
While the printer size is not the most compact, and the weight is quite heavy, compared to other color laser printers this stacks up well in those areas. The HP Color LaserJet 1600and HP Color LaserJet 3600n are much taller and bigger overall. And while the Samsung CLP-300N Network-ready Color Laser Printer is smaller, this Phaser isn't much bigger and has much better quality prints. Those with a small business or home office will find size to be acceptable given the performance.
Conclusion
This is a very nice performing color laser printer at an acceptable price. It's not the cheapest or the most expensive. While the size is acceptable, it may be large for very small workstations. Many people will need an all-in-one printer that also offers scanning and copying functionality. In this price range, the models that have that capacity are mostly black and white printers, though some offer color scanning. So if you need color printing, this may definitely be the way to go. For general printing needs, color power point decks or the like, this is a very good alternative for you.
